The Great Camera Clean Up!

Eh, not great.  Been wiping down and dusting 4 cameras. Two pocket sized point and shoots, and one slightly larger one, and a micro 4/3s, and one mirrorless full frame.

One of the little ones is an Olympus SH-1. Easy to clean, but a pain to charge the battery. Have to have it plugged into a USB port. Very slow to charge.

The other small one is a Canon S95. Comes with a battery charger, and charged them up very quickly. 

The slightly larger one is an Olympus Stylus 1. Cleaned up ok, but the zooming knob would stick. A very careful application of liquid silicone on it, and it works as if brand new.

Next one, Olympus E-M1mII.  Just needed dusting and a battery swap out.

Last but definitely not least, Canon R5. Didn’t need much, but I did give it a good going over with dust brush, and microfiber cloth, and checked battery status. All good.

Saturday, October 11, 2025

And internet history repeats..

Yeah, they said they sent out emails, and posted it on their own blog, but I got it, and I looked through all my email accounts, including spam folders.

With no warning, TypePad closed up. I found out by trying to post to it, as usual, and got some error message. I clicked on link to my blog page, and got this huge CLOSED graphic, with lame-assed excuses as to why we could no longer even archive the weblogs.  If this sounds familiar, it's because this was exactly what 6Apart did to Vox blog back in 2010.

So yeah, I am pissed off.
